Population in Sanocki County 2019

In 2019, Sanocki county ranked 133 of 380 Polish counties. Population shrank by 1,441 residents -1.5% between 2014-2019, at 94,385.

Among 339 declining counties, in the lower half for rate of decline. Within Subcarpathian province, ranked 9 of 25 counties.

Based on 31 years of official GUS statistics for Sanocki county and its 8 municipalities within Subcarpathian province.
